NOA Marks World Suicide Prevention Day, Calls for End to Stigma

World Suicide Prevention Day, observed globally on September 10 every year, highlights the urgent need to tackle mental health issues, promote hope, and reduce the stigma associated with suicide.

Tijjani noted that the NOA joined the rest of the world to raise awareness, break the silence, and remind Nigerians that suicide is preventable. He explained that more than 720,000 lives are lost annually to suicide worldwide, with devastating effects on families and communities.

The NOA director urged Nigerians to listen with patience and without judgment, while encouraging those struggling with mental health challenges to seek professional help from doctors, counsellors or hotlines. He also emphasized the importance of sharing information about available support systems.

“Use words that heal. Your kindness and care can bring hope. World Suicide Prevention Day is not only about remembrance but about hope. Let us stand together against stigma and show that every life matters” Tijjani added.
